5.0 out of 5 stars An essential, historical, comprehensive scholarly reference., May 4, 2000
This review is from: Ten Thousand Years of Pottery (Hardcover)
Now in a fully updated and expanded fourth edition, Ten Thousand Years Of Pottery continues to be a wonderfully lavish and illustrated history of pottery making from its antiquarian beginnings with the earliest Near East and Middle civilizations to the present day. A global perspective is taken with representations from the Mediterranean, Asian, Islamic, Meso American, neolithic Britain, to the Wedgwood and de Morgan factories, contemporary Africa, India, Scandinavia, and Australasia. Ten Thousand Years Of Pottery concludes with detailed and comprehensive analysis of the development off ceramics as a medium of personal expression by present day artists and studio potters. Ten Thousand Years Of Pottery is an essential historical, critical, scholarly, and very highly recommended reference drawing upon the immense informational resources and artifacts from museums, collectors, and practicing potters.

5.0 out of 5 stars very satisfying (for an amateur), March 26, 2011
By 
Very glad to have it...Cooper seems to have an incredible amount of knowledge to provide a lot in detail to the large subject here. Either that or he did an a lot of research. It's also written and organized well - again, not easy for a history book covering a technology that developed around the world at different times. I am an amateur potter and never took any art history, so I have no benchmark for this book other than what i'd like to learn about the history of pottery. There are many, many good photos - probably 1-3 per page - but i wish there more to complement Cooper's intriguing descriptions.
